A Turbulent Finish for E W Scripps
Numbers don’t lie, and right now, E W Scripps (NASDAQ: SSP) is spinning in the mud. Their Q4 earnings report dropped the other day, and let’s just say it wasn’t pretty. Brace yourself—it missed earnings estimates by a staggering 828.57%. With an EPS of $-0.51 in the rearview, versus an estimated $0.07, we’re looking at a company that needs to hit the reboot button. Revenue Outlook Dims
Comparing fiscal health year-on-year, E W Scripps saw revenue tumble by $168.12 million from this time last year. Yikes! Learning from Previous Misses
Now, let’s rewind to the last quarter—remember they had a miss on EPS by just $0.14? The aftermath saw a wild ride, with a 24.88% share price boost the very next day. So what gives?
